Bing Webmaster Tools
Microsoft’s Bing Webmaster Tools helps webmasters manage their website’s presence on the Bing search engine. With Bing Webmaster Tools, webmasters can submit their websites to Bing, track their traffic from Bing, and troubleshoot any issues their websites may have with Bing. Webmasters can also use Bing Webmaster Tools to understand how Bing sees their website and to improve their website to rank higher on Bing.
Great for: Tracking Bing rankings, Technical SEO.

Google Search Console
Webmasters and SEOs can track their website’s search performance with Google Search Console. This tool provides a lot of useful information, such as the number of impressions and clicks your website receives in Google Search, the average position of your website in search results, and the query people use to find your site.
Great for: Track search performance, Technical SEO.

HeadingsMap
The HeadingsMap is a FREE Chrome extension that provides a visual representation of the heading structure of a webpage, making it easier to identify any potential issues with the hierarchy of headings and make necessary adjustments.
Installing HeadingsMap is easy – just add the extension to your Chrome browser and click on the small icon to activate it. The extension will then generate a colour-coded map of the headings on the page, making it easy to identify any potential issues with the hierarchy of headings and make necessary adjustments.
But that’s not all – HeadingsMap also includes other useful features such as the ability to toggle on and off different heading levels, highlight headings with specific keywords, and more.

Microsoft Clarity
Microsoft Clarity is an excellent tool for improving a website’s user experience. You can use this tool to identify areas of your website that may be confusing to users or difficult to navigate. It takes only a few lines of code to add Clarity to your website and it will create heatmaps and video recordings of your users navigating it.
Great for: User Experience.

Xenu
If you’re looking for a broken link checker, Xenu is a great choice. This free, lightweight tool scans your site for broken links quickly. You can enter your URL and Xenu will crawl your site, checking every link for functionality. Xenu will report any broken links it finds.
Great for: Finding and fixing broken links on your website.
